From: Molecular basis of a novel adaptation to hypoxic-hypercapnia in a strictly fossorial mole

Figure 2

Values of PO 2 and Hill's cooperativity coefficient at half oxygen saturation (P 50 and n 50 ) for the two major isohemoglobin components of (A) eastern and (B) coast moles at 37°C, and their pH dependence in the absence and presence of added Cl- (0.1 M) and 2,3-DPG (DPG/Hb 4 ratio > 50). Upper right insets: diagrams of isoelectric focusing column at the end of focusing illustrating the relative abundance of the individual hemoglobin components and their isoelectric points at 5°C.
